Property Details for 47 Kerferd St, Coburg

47 Kerferd St, Coburg is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1945. The property has a land size of 380m2 and floor size of 111m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last transferred in November 2008.

About Coburg 3058

The size of Coburg is approximately 7.0 square kilometres. It has 33 parks covering nearly 7.4% of total area. The population of Coburg in 2016 was 26185 people. By 2021 the population was 26574 showing a population growth of 1.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Coburg is 30-39 years. Households in Coburg are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Coburg work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.30% of the homes in Coburg were owner-occupied compared with 62.80% in 2016.

Coburg has 15,017 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Coburg have seen a 21.41%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 14.91% increase. As at 31 December 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Coburg is $1,301,225 while the median value for Units is $659,339.
  • Houses have a median rent of $695 while Units have a median rent of $560.
There are currently 29 properties listed for sale, and 25 properties listed for rent in Coburg on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 646 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Coburg.
